Ошибка 1001 Указанная служба не существует в качестве установленной службы - PullRequest
2 голосов
/ 26 июля 2011

Я тестирую установщик Windows, который я сделал для одного из моих приложений. Я получил следующую ошибку при удалении

Тип события: ошибка Источник события: MsiInstaller Категория события: нет Код события: 11001 Дата: 25.07.2011 Время: 16:36:16 Пользователь:
Компьютер:
Описание: Описание для идентификатора события (11001) в источнике (MsiInstaller) не может быть найдено. Локальный компьютер может не иметь необходимой информации реестра или файлов DLL сообщений для отображения сообщений с удаленного компьютера. Вы можете использовать флаг / AUXSOURCE =, чтобы получить это описание; см. Помощь и Поддержка для деталей. Следующая информация является частью события: Продукт: - Ошибка 1001. Ошибка 1001. Исключительная ситуация при удалении. Это исключение будет проигнорировано, и удаление продолжится. Тем не менее, приложение может быть не полностью удалено после завершения удаления. -> Указанная служба не существует как установленная служба, (NULL), (NULL), (NULL). Данные: 0000: 7b 31 37 43 45 36 35 42 {17CE65B 0008: 32 2d 37 33 34 33 2d 34 2-7343-4 0010: 43 32 38 2d 41 31 45 39 C28-A1E9 0018: 2d 34 31 45 36 39 39 37 -41E6997 0020: 37 46 45 41 44 7d 7FEAD}

сценарий был

  1. установил приложение, используя проект установки VS 2008 - он устанавливает службу

  2. остановил и удалил службу, используя 'sc delete servicename.exe' из командной строки

  3. попытался удалить приложение с панели управления

Параметр RemovePreviousVersions имеет значение True в моем случае. Это правильный сценарий или программа установки не предназначена для того, чтобы выдержать такого рода испытания на устойчивость?

Может ли кто-нибудь помочь мне решить эту проблему?

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...